Compartilhar via


CRYPT_XML_KEYINFO_SPEC enumeração (cryptxml.h)

A enumeração CRYPT_XML_KEYINFO_SPEC especifica valores para o parâmetro dwKeyInfoSpec na função CryptXmlSign .

Syntax

typedef enum {
  CRYPT_XML_KEYINFO_SPEC_NONE = 0,
  CRYPT_XML_KEYINFO_SPEC_ENCODED = 1,
  CRYPT_XML_KEYINFO_SPEC_PARAM = 2
} CRYPT_XML_KEYINFO_SPEC;

Constantes

 
CRYPT_XML_KEYINFO_SPEC_NONE
Valor: 0
O valor do membro KeyInfo na estrutura CRYPT_XML_SIGNATURE é nulo.
CRYPT_XML_KEYINFO_SPEC_ENCODED
Valor: 1
O valor da estrutura de CRYPT_XML_KEY_INFO codificada é especificado em uma estrutura CRYPT_XML_BLOB apontada no parâmetro pvKeyInfoSpec .
CRYPT_XML_KEYINFO_SPEC_PARAM
Valor: 2
Os membros da estrutura CRYPT_XML_KEY_INFO a ser codificada são especificados em uma estrutura CRYPT_XML_KEYINFO_PARAM apontada pelo parâmetro pvKeyInfoSpec .

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ows 7 [somente aplicativos da área de trabalho]
Servidor mínimo com suporte Windows Server 2008 R2 [somente aplicativos da área de trabalho]
Cabeçalho cryptxml.h